16 / 24 page ![]() AD8307 Data Sheet Rev. F | Page 16 of 24 It can be desirable to increase the speed of the output response, with the penalty of increased ripple. One way to do this is by connecting a shunt load resistor from the OUT pin to ground, which raises the low-pass corner frequency. This also alters the logarithmic slope, for example, to 7.5 mV/dB using a 5.36 kΩ resistor, while reducing the 10% to 90% rise time to 25 ns. The ripple amplitude for the 50 MHz input remains at 0.5 mV, but this is now equivalent to ±0.07 dB. If a negative supply is available, the output pin can be connected directly to the summing node of an external op amp connected as an inverting mode transresis- tance stage. Note that while the AD8307 can operate down to supply voltages of 2.7 V, the output voltage limit is reduced when the supply drops below 4 V. This characteristic is the result of necessary headroom requirements, approximately two VBE drops, in the design of the output stage. 1.25kΩ 25mV/dB OUT 2µA/dB 0µA TO 220µA INT FROM ALL DETECTORS CFLT C2 1pF VPS BIAS 1.25kΩ 1.25kΩ ~400mV 8.25kΩ 60kΩ 60µA COM R1 12.5kΩ C1 2.5pF 3pF LGP LGM 1.25kΩ 4 7 5 2 Figure 31.
